Site Preparation
Robust solutions:This applies to every layer below the road surface or structure, from the subgrade to
frost protection
and
base layers
.Through
soil stabilization
and
high-grade compaction
, these layers gain the necessary load-bearing capacity and can act as the foundation for long-lasting roads and buildings. In short: building for the long term begins with the
soil.
Pavement replacement
Fast and effective: Roads have to withstand heavy loads, which over time lead to fatigue and deterioration and cause serious long-term damage. As long as only the top layer of the road structure is affected,
Surface Layer Rehabilitation
is an appropriate maintenance measure.
Paving Thin Layers Hot
A streamlined solution:
Paving Thin Layers Hot
is the perfect solution for roads in need of rehabilitation that only exhibit surface damage. A particularly cost-effective alternative to complete rehabilitation is the
“paving thin layers hot”
process using a paver with spray assembly for bitumen emulsion from
VÖGELE.

Asphalt recycling
The asphalt cycle: In industrially developed countries, significantly more
roads are rehabilitated
or extended than completely new roads are built. But what happens to the old road surface?
Recycling asphalt
is an economic imperative in order to conserve natural resources.
